Section 52
Minors or non-residents shall begin the statute of limitations

(1) If a person who has to file a complaint is a minor, the limitation period shall be deemed to have started from the day he became an adult.
(2) If the person to file a complaint does not stay at his home address before the period of limitation begins, the period of limitation shall be deemed to have started from the day he arrives at his home address.
(3) If a person does not remain at his home address after the commencement of the limitation period, the period during which he is not at his address at the beginning and end of the limitation period shall be counted as the period, if the complaint is filed within the period of the limitation period, it shall be considered that the complaint has been filed within the limitation period. If the period is less than fifteen days, then the period of fifteen days will be considered to have expired.
